The majority of the cleaning company operators we consulted with used individual cost savings to begin their companies, then reinvested their early profits to money growth - commercial cleaning service. If you need to purchase devices, you need to be able to discover financing, specifically if you can show that you've put some of your own money into business.

Some recommendations: Do an extensive inventory of your properties. Individuals generally have more properties than they immediately recognize. This might consist of cost savings accounts, equity in real estate, pension, automobiles, leisure devices, collections and other investments. You might choose to sell assets for cash or use them as collateral for a loan.

Numerous an effective business has been begun with charge card. The next rational action after gathering your own resources is to approach friends and family members who believe in you and wish to assist you be successful. Beware with these plans; no matter how close you are, present yourself professionally, put everything in composing, and be sure the individuals you approach can pay for to take the threat of buying your organization.

Utilizing the "strength in numbers" concept, take a look around for somebody who might want to team up with you in your venture. You may choose somebody who has funds and wants to work side-by-side with you in business. Or you might find somebody who has cash to invest however no interest in doing the real work.

Take advantage of the abundance of local, state and federal programs designed to support small companies. Make your first stop the U.S. Small company Administration; then examine various other programs. Ladies, minorities and veterans ought to have a look at specific niche funding possibilities created to help these groups enter service. In reality, your cars are basically your company on wheels. They need to be carefully chosen and properly maintained to effectively serve and represent you. For a house maid service, an economy car or station wagon ought to be adequate. You need enough space to shop equipment and products, and to transport your cleaning teams, but you typically will not be transporting around pieces of equipment large enough to need a van or small truck.

If you offer the vehicles, paint your company's name, logo and phone number on them. This markets your service all over town. If your employees utilize their own cars and trucks-- which is especially typical with housemaid services-- request for evidence that they have sufficient insurance to cover them in case of an accident.

The type of vehicles you'll need for a janitorial service depends upon the size and kind of equipment you use in addition to the size and variety of your crews. An economy car or station wagon could work if you're doing fairly light cleansing in smaller offices, but for many janitorial services, you're more most likely to need a truck or van.

A great utilized truck will cost about $10,000, while a new one will run from $18,000 up. Coordinate your billing system with your customers' payable procedures. office cleaning services near me. Openly ask what you can do to ensure timely payment; that might include validating the appropriate billing address and learning what paperwork may be needed to assist the client identify the validity of the billing. Bear in mind that lots of big business pay particular kinds of billings on particular days of the month; learn if your customers do that, and schedule your billings to get here in time for the next payment cycle.

Terms include the date the invoice is due, any discount for early payment and service charges for late payment. It's likewise a great concept to particularly state the date the billing ends up being past due to prevent any possible misconception. If you're going to charge a charge for late payment, make certain your invoice states that it's a late payment or rebilling cost, not a financing charge.

Point out any approaching specials, brand-new services or other information that might encourage your consumers to utilize more of your services. Add a flier or sales brochure to the envelope-- despite the fact that the invoice is going to an existing consumer, you never ever know where your pamphlets will wind up.
